FPU2025 - Productividad transcripcional de los contactos entre enhancers y promotores

We previously implemented a synthetic engineering approach to systematically compare the regulatory properties of different types of enhancers (Pachano et al., Nat Genet, 2021). Using this synthetic engineering approach, we recently uncovered that the strong regulatory activity of enhancers clusters (i.e. super-enhancers) can not be explained by changes in enhancer-promoter contact frequency or the formation of transcriptional condensates. Instead, our data suggest that the emergent regulatory properties of enhancer clustering might preferentially entail an increase in the fraction of transcriptionally productive enhancer-promoter contacts (Haro et al., bioRxiv, 2025). We now aim at systematically evaluating whether different types of enhancers control target gene expression by preferentially increasing either enhancer–promoter contact frequency and/or the productivity of such contacts.
